Dragonfly Energy Puts Education First by Partnering with Florida’s Largest RV Trade Association for Lithium Power Training
09 August 2023 - 1:30PM
Illustrating its deep-seated commitment to lithium power education,
Dragonfly Energy Holdings Corp. (Nasdaq: DFLI) (“Dragonfly Energy”
or the “Company”), maker of Battle Born BatteriesTM and an industry
leader in energy storage, recently partnered with Florida’s largest
RV trade association, FRVTA, to conduct a training seminar on
lithium power for RVs.
The Florida RV Trade Association (FRVTA) worked
with a team of technical specialists from Dragonfly Energy to
conduct this in-depth training seminar. The FRVTA is a leading U.S.
RV trade association that hosts annual RV shows that draw
attendance of more than 100,000 — including one of the nation’s
largest, the Florida RV Supershow, held annually in Tampa, Florida.
Additionally, as part of its educational mission, the FRVTA
provides members with hands-on skills education like this August
workshop from Dragonfly Energy, allowing participants to earn
approved CEUs for industry certification requirements.
During the session, Dragonfly Energy specialists
covered topics including:
- Proper safety and care of Battle
Born lithium deep cycle battery systems, including installation
tips
- Practical knowledge about how
lithium-ion batteries are integrated into RV electrical
systems
- Insights into upcoming Dragonfly
Energy technology that will continue to enhance and revolutionize
the RV industry
A professionally produced video recording of the
workshop is to be released publicly as a component of the
educational material available for free through Battle Born
Academy. This resource-heavy website is dedicated to educating and
empowering readers, including original equipment manufacturers,
installers, and DIYers, who are seeking information about lithium
batteries. Dragonfly Energy leadership believes that education is a
cornerstone to the lithium battery industry, ensuring safe and
proper installation and comprehensive knowledge across the
industry.
The seminar complements other Battle Born
Academy materials, like deep-dive videos about lithium battery
technology, practical information about tax incentives (including
credits for lithium power systems in RVs), and infographics like
this explanation of how to size an RV solar system, among other
resources.

About Dragonfly EnergyDragonfly
Energy Holdings Corp. (Nasdaq: DFLI) headquartered in Reno, Nevada,
is a leading supplier of deep cycle lithium-ion batteries.
Dragonfly Energy’s research and development initiatives are
revolutionizing the energy storage industry through innovative
technologies and manufacturing processes. Today, Dragonfly Energy’s
non-toxic deep cycle lithium-ion batteries are displacing lead-acid
batteries across a wide range of end-markets, including RVs, marine
vessels, off-grid installations, and other storage applications.
Dragonfly Energy is also focused on delivering an energy storage
solution to enable a more sustainable and reliable smart grid
through the future deployment of its proprietary and patented
solid-state cell technology. To learn more,
